Step-by-Step Guide for Mileage Correction
Step 1: Verify TCU Type
Before proceeding, ensure that you confirm the TCU is the new type, which should have a 7-pin plug. This verification is critical, as older models may utilize a different connection method.
Step 2: Connect the Device
Open the hood of the vehicle, locate the original gearbox connector, and disconnect it. Connect the Mini ACDP-1/ACDP-2 device to the gearbox using the corresponding Module 45 SH25xx-0DE interface board. Be sure to position the jumper cap to the “CAN-R” end as indicated. Following this, power on the ACDP device.
Step 3: Identify Information
Open the ACDP app on your mobile device. After confirming that your ACDP device is connected, navigate through the interface by selecting VW/AUDI -> Gearbox RD/WR -> VW -> DQ38x_Gen2 (0DE/0GC). Tap “Identify info” to retrieve the system information, including the current mileage (for example, 17150km) and the system run time (for example, 453h). It's advisable to take a screenshot of this information for your records.
Step 4: Correct Mileage (Auto Mode)
To initiate the mileage correction process, click on “Mileage correction (auto mode)”. The app will read the system and chip information, allowing you to save the EEPROM data. Enter the desired new mileage, such as 16300km, and start writing the chip data. The calibration process will be completed once the writing is successful.
Step 5: Correct Time (Auto Mode)
Similarly, for time correction, click on “Time correction (auto mode)”. Confirm the system information presented. The mileage will now reflect the modified value. Save the EEPROM data and enter the new system run time (for example, 450). You are now ready to write the chip, and upon completion, the run time correction will be successful!
Notes for Users
If you have already purchased any of the following modules, you can acquire only the Module 45 license (A60B) without needing the Module 45 hardware to access DQ38x Gen2 functionality:
- ACDP Module 19 / ACDP2 Module 19
- ACDP Module 25 / ACDP2 Module 25
- ACDP Module 30 / ACDP2 Module 30
